The Bamberg Foundation, which seeks the promotion of health technologies and the everis health division, everis health, have come to a cooperation agreement to promote initiatives related to health innovation and sustainability of the health system. During the signing, the president of the Bamberg Foundation, Ignacio Para and the partner responsible for everis health, Santiago Martín were present.
This agreement, with scope of application in Spain, Portugal and Latin America, will be built through various initiatives to discuss and encourage health innovation, advanced health delivery modalities or interoperability in the public and private sector
According to the president of the Bamberg Foundation, Ignacio Para, "with this agreement we want to encourage communication initiatives and knowledge sharing among professionals, care centers and medical technology companies."
For his part, the partner responsible for everis health, Santiago Martin said, "ICTs are called to play a significant role in increasing the quality and sustainability of the health system. This agreement provides a joint vision to continue meeting our objective, namely to develop actions aimed at improving efficiency and quality of the health sector. "
Thus, as first initiative resulting from this agreement, everis will participate in the Health Leaders International Meeting that will be held in Madrid from the 1st to the 3rd of December, 2010. The conference aims to reflect on the state of global health, their interaction in a globalized world and its effect on the economy.
